Pop music and radio go back a long way. In fact, one might say that without radio, there wouldn’t be any pop music. Louis Armstrong, Bill Monroe, Frank Sinatra, Elvis Presley, and even The Beatles owed their success in large part to the airplay they received.

Many artists have repaid the favor over the decades by writing and recording pop songs that are about radio in one way or another. Which is your favorite?
